The AAMC submitted comments to the White House Office of Science and Technology Policy (OSTP) in response to a request for information on federal policies that aim to “accelerate the American scientific enterprise.”
In its Dec. 22 letter, the AAMC stressed the vital role of academic medicine in the research ecosystem (PDF) and provided recommendations to improve policies and processes for issues such as regulatory burden, licensing, and ensuring that the benefits of research are available to all. The AAMC also encouraged the OSTP to solicit community input as it considers new initiatives and directions, whether through town halls, webinars, or formal requests for information.
